Will abortion affect fertility?

No, abortion does not affect future fertility when completed without complications. This is one of the most misunderstood topics in reproductive health and the clinical evidence is clear and consistent. Can a fetus survive after taking misoprostol?

A fetus can survive after misoprostol if the medication fails to terminate the pregnancy. This is called a failed abortion and occurs in approximately 2 to 5 percent of medication abortion cases depending on gestational age and whether mifepristone was used alongside misoprostol. Can I take 4 misoprostol without mifepristone?

Yes, misoprostol can be used without mifepristone, but the combination regimen is significantly more effective and is always the preferred clinical option when mifepristone is accessible. Can we take 4 misoprostol orally?

Yes, 4 misoprostol tablets can be taken orally, but oral swallowing is actually the least effective administration route for medication abortion and is not the standard recommended method.
